自動(dòng)語(yǔ)音報(bào)站系統(tǒng)是利用GPS技術(shù)(全球衛(wèi)星定位技術(shù))和語(yǔ)音合成技術(shù)(文本轉(zhuǎn)語(yǔ)音),無(wú)需人工干預(yù),就可以實(shí)現(xiàn)實(shí)時(shí)的全自動(dòng)智能合成語(yǔ)音報(bào)站。
系統(tǒng)原理
自動(dòng)語(yǔ)音報(bào)站系統(tǒng)的原理是GPS模塊接收所選衛(wèi)星發(fā)來(lái)的導(dǎo)航信息和時(shí)間,計(jì)算出車輛當(dāng)前的經(jīng)緯度坐標(biāo)信息。將此坐標(biāo)信息與存儲(chǔ)在單片機(jī)中的車站的經(jīng)緯度坐標(biāo)信息比對(duì),就可查得車站站名信息,然后由集成了高端語(yǔ)音合成芯片SYN6658的語(yǔ)音播報(bào)器播報(bào)出來(lái)。如圖所示:
系統(tǒng)構(gòu)成
本系統(tǒng)由天線,GPS定位模塊,單片機(jī),語(yǔ)音合成模塊組成。
天線負(fù)責(zé)接受衛(wèi)星信號(hào)并傳輸GPS模塊。
GPS模塊接收定位信息然后輸出包括經(jīng)緯度,海拔,速度,日期/時(shí)間,誤差估計(jì)等信息給單片機(jī)。 從GPS板接收的數(shù)據(jù)流是文本字符串,可根據(jù)GPS輸出數(shù)據(jù)NMEA-0183通信標(biāo)準(zhǔn)格式所定義的各種記錄語(yǔ)句的結(jié)構(gòu)組成特點(diǎn),編制程序解析其中有用信息。
單片機(jī)中儲(chǔ)存了車站的經(jīng)緯度信息,并可以接收來(lái)自GPS模塊的信息,經(jīng)過(guò)一系列的對(duì)比分析,得出要播報(bào)的站名等文本結(jié)果然后傳送給語(yǔ)音播報(bào)模塊。
語(yǔ)音合成模塊集成了高端TTS芯片SYN6658,直接把文本轉(zhuǎn)語(yǔ)音輸出,實(shí)現(xiàn)了最終的語(yǔ)音播報(bào)功能。SYN6658是嵌入式高端中文語(yǔ)音合成芯片,該芯片支持異步串口(UART)、SPI兩種通信方式接收待合成的文本,直接合成語(yǔ)音輸出;SYN6658語(yǔ)音芯片支持GB2312,GBK,BIG5,UNICODE 4種內(nèi)碼格式的文本,具有智能的文本分析處理算法,可正確識(shí)別和處理數(shù)值、號(hào)碼、時(shí)間的度量衡符號(hào),具備較強(qiáng)多音字處理能力;提供兩男、兩女、一個(gè)效果器和一個(gè)女童聲共6個(gè)中文發(fā)音人;支持多種控制命令,包括:合成、停止、暫停合成、繼續(xù)合成、改變波特率等;而且還具有緩存排序功能。
結(jié)束語(yǔ)
自動(dòng)語(yǔ)音報(bào)站系統(tǒng)根據(jù)公交報(bào)站的具體要求,系統(tǒng)還可繼續(xù)完善。本系統(tǒng)不僅能夠把司機(jī)徹底從報(bào)站任務(wù)中解放出來(lái),并減少交流隱患。還可以可以節(jié)省員工開(kāi)支,增強(qiáng)公司效益。又可以利用報(bào)站器播報(bào)標(biāo)準(zhǔn)的普通話站名,使各城市更利于交流和發(fā)展。